WebTsunami Characteristics. Tsunamis are characterized as shallow-water waves. Shallow-water waves are different from wind-generated waves, the waves many of us have observed at the beach. WebLactate dehydrogenase as well as alcohol dehydrogenase has been detected in germinating seeds. There is evidence for the existence of the pentose phosphate cycle in seeds. Glucose-6-phosphate and phosphogluconate dehydrogenases have been shown in a number of seeds, including wheat and lettuce.

Web6-phosphogluconate dehydrogenase (6PGDH) catalyzes the reversible oxidative decarboxylation of 6-phosphogluconate (6PG) to ribulose-5-phosphate (Ru5P) and CO 2.
